An Oregon Release of Purchase Contract — Residential is a legal document used to formally cancel or terminate a purchase agreement for a residential property in the state of Oregon. This contract release is designed to provide a clear understanding between parties involved and release them from any obligations or liabilities associated with the original agreement. Mutual Agreement Release: This type of release occurs when both the buyer and seller mutually agree to terminate the purchase contract. It is commonly used when both parties find it mutually beneficial to end the agreement due to changed circumstances or other reasons. 2. Contingency Release: A contingency release occurs when a specific condition or contingency mentioned within the purchase contract is not met. For example, if the buyer is unable to secure financing within the agreed-upon timeframe, this release allows them to exit the contract without penalty. 3. Inspection Contingency Release: This release specifically addresses the buyer's right to perform inspections on the property. If the inspections uncover significant issues that the buyer is unwilling to negotiate or rectify, this release allows them to terminate the contract. 4. Seller's Disclosure Release: If the seller fails to provide accurate or complete information regarding the property's condition or history as required by law, the buyer may have the option to terminate the purchase contract using a seller's disclosure release. 5. Default Release: In cases where one party fails to fulfill their obligations or breaches the terms of the purchase agreement, the innocent party can utilize a default release to cancel the contract and possibly seek legal remedies for any damages incurred. 6. Time-Release: This type of release is valid when the buyer or seller fails to meet specific deadlines or timeframes outlined in the purchase contract. It provides a means to terminate the agreement if either party fails to adhere to the agreed-upon timelines. Utilizing an Oregon Release of Purchase Contract — Residential is crucial to ensure a smooth and legally binding termination of a purchase agreement. It is advised to consult with legal professionals or real estate agents familiar with Oregon state laws to ensure the appropriate release is used for the specific circumstances.
